    ... The aim of breathing exercises is to relax the chest muscles that are overworked...

    ... And to teach a person to get out of the habit of using the chest muscles for breathing and start using the abdominal muscles and the diaphragm...

    ... For learning the proper use of diaphragm and lower chest the asthma patient has to start concentrating on breathing out rather than breathing in...

    ... The chest has to be completely emptied by raising the diaphragm by voluntary contraction of the abdominal muscles and lower chest...

    ... By doing this exercise a person tries to achieve the reversal of the condition of asthmatic attack...

    ... Alternatives for Allergies and Asthma: Proceed with Caution...

    ... So it's no surprise that many Americans are turning to complementary and alternative (CAM) therapies to treat their allergy and asthma symptoms...

    ... When it comes to conditions for which people seek out nontraditional treatments, studies suggest that asthma and allergies are second only to lower back pain...

    ... It's estimated that allergies affect 40 to 50 million Americans, and about 20 million have asthma...

    ... You may wonder why people are turning to alternatives when there are many medications, both prescription and over-the-counter, that successfully treat asthma and allergies...

    ... Like many people with chronic medical conditions, those who suffer from asthma and allergies are often particularly interested in trying new, “natural” treatments...

    ... Another driving force behind the move toward alternative remedies may be the high cost of allergy and asthma medicines, says Dr...

    ... Gailen Marshall, a professor of medicine and director of the clinical immunology, asthma and allergy division at the University of Mississippi in Jackson...

    ... For example, some patients who have both allergies and asthma may choose to only treat their asthma to cut costs...

    ... But they may run into trouble quickly, because flaring allergies can worsen asthma symptoms...

    ... In a study published in a supplement devoted to CAM therapies in the Annals of Allergy, Asthma and Immunology, Dr...

    ... Leonard Bielory of the UMDNJ-New Jersey Medical School in Newark reviewed the medical literature to uncover the possible benefits as well as consequences of popular CAM therapies for asthma, allergies and immune system conditions...

    ... There have also been some reports linking echinacea to asthma attacks, life-threatening anaphylactic reactions, and worsening of asthma and allergies symptoms...

    ... Likewise, bee pollen, a CAM therapy sometimes used for asthma and allergies, has been shown to trigger sore throat and breathing problems...

    ... Ginkgo biloba, which has been shown to expand the air passages in the lungs, is sometimes recommended to people with asthma...
